| /* |
| |
| This program generates the "times.h" file with the zulu-times of the first of |
| every month of a decade. |
| |
| */ |

| #include <time.h> |
| #include <stdio.h> |
| |
| static time_t GetDay(int D,int M,int Y) |
| { |
| struct tm TM; |
| |
| TM.tm_sec = 0; |
| TM.tm_min = 0; |
| TM.tm_hour = 0; |
| TM.tm_mday = D; |
| TM.tm_mon = M; |
| TM.tm_wday = 0; |
| TM.tm_yday = 0; |
| TM.tm_year = Y-1900; |
| TM.tm_isdst = 0; |
| |
| return mktime(&TM); |
| |
| } |
| static int WeekGetDay(int D,int M,int Y) |
| { |
| struct tm TM; |
| |
| TM.tm_sec = 0; |
| TM.tm_min = 0; |
| TM.tm_hour = 0; |
| TM.tm_mday = D; |
| TM.tm_mon = M; |
| TM.tm_year = Y-1900; |
| TM.tm_isdst = 0; |
| TM.tm_wday = 0; |
| TM.tm_yday = 0; |
| |
| (void)mktime(&TM); |
| |
| return TM.tm_wday; |
| |
| } |
| |
| int main(void) |
| { |
| int M,Y; |
| FILE *file; |
| |
| file=fopen("times.h","w"); |
| |
| if (file==NULL) |
| return 0; |
| |
| fprintf(file,"static time_t TimeDays[10][13] = { \n"); |
| |
| Y=1997; |
| while (Y<2007) |
| { |
| M=0; |
| fprintf(file," { "); |
| while (M<12) |
| { |
| fprintf(file,"%i",(int)GetDay(1,M,Y)); |
| fprintf(file,",\t"); |
| |
| M++; |
| } |
| |
| fprintf(file,"%i } ",(int)GetDay(1,0,Y+1)); |
| if (Y!=2006) fprintf(file,","); |
| fprintf(file,"\n"); |
| Y++; |
| } |
| fprintf(file,"};\n"); |
| |
| fprintf(file,"static int WeekDays[10][13] = { \n"); |
| |
| Y=1997; |
| while (Y<2007) |
| { |
| M=0; |
| fprintf(file," { "); |
| while (M<12) |
| { |
| fprintf(file,"%i",(int)WeekGetDay(1,M,Y)); |
| fprintf(file,",\t"); |
| |
| M++; |
| } |
| |
| fprintf(file,"%i } ",(int)WeekGetDay(1,0,Y+1)); |
| if (Y!=2006) fprintf(file,","); |
| fprintf(file,"\n"); |
| Y++; |
| } |
| fprintf(file,"};\n"); |
| fprintf(file,"#define KHTTPD_YEAROFFSET 1997\n"); |
| fprintf(file,"#define KHTTPD_NUMYEARS 10\n"); |
| (void)fclose(file); |
| |
| return 0; |
| } |
